As a Senior Software Engineer on the Automotive Client Insights nVision Product Team, you will be a leader on the team that designs and develops robust and scalable analytics processing applications. You will implement data access services that operate with maximum throughput and minimum latency.

You will be an accomplished, well-rounded developer with a solid understanding of the appropriate use of best practices and frameworks for high volume data processing and analytics. You will mentor junior engineers on good software practices. You will be passionate about exploring the use of innovative technologies and techniques and evaluating them for suitability in our environment.

Your Role:

Design and develop code that consistently adheres to good programming practices

Design, develop, and maintain high volume Java and Scala based data processing jobs using industry standard tools and frameworks in the Hadoop ecosystem, such as Spark, Kafka, Hive, Impala, Avro, Flume, Oozie, and Sqoop

Design and maintain schemas in our analytics database

Write efficient SQL for loading and querying data

Collaborate with product managers and technologists to solve business problems

Mentor junior engineers with all aspects of software development

Live by Agile (particularly Scrum) principles and collaborate with team members using Agile techniques including test driven development, code reviews, and retrospectives

Maintain Cox Automotive position as an industry leader by exploring innovative technologies, languages, and techniques in the rapidly evolving world of high-volume data processing

Technologies We Use:

Development languages/frameworks: Java/Scala, Apache Spark, Kafka, Vertica, JavaScript (React / Redux), MicroStrategy

Amazon: EMR, Step Functions, SQS, LaMDA and AWS cloud-native architectures

DevOps Tools: Terraform or Cloud Formation, NewRelic, Jenkins, Grafana, PagerDuty, GitHub, GitHub Actions

Database: MySQL, Vertica, DynamoDB

Stream Processing: Kafka, Spark Streaming, Kinesis
